OpenAI recently published an AI-generated proof and Lean language writeup tackling the Navier-Stokes existence and smoothness problem. While OpenAI frames this as a formal contribution to one of the most difficult challenges in fluid dynamics, external academic observers, specifically from NYU, characterize the effort as lacking the necessary rigor for a valid proof. The contradiction highlights a gap between AI-driven mathematical outputs and the traditional peer-review standards required for the $1 million Millennium Prize. Whether this approach serves as a legitimate foundation for a solution or merely a symbolic demonstration will depend on further verification by the broader mathematical community.
